dragonXAOC писал(а):Оставил в rc.Cong только:
hostname="dragonXAOC"
ifconfig_ue0="DHCP"
Ничего не изменилось. Как проверить второй вариант (со статикой) я не знаю. Как можно узнать defaultrouter?
rc.conf - вообще-то.
Вы хотите использовать Tethering своего смартфона для выхода ПК-с-FreeBSD в интернет?
https://www.freebsd.org/doc/handbook/ne ... ering.html
если у Вас ue0 появился, значит USB-Ethernet работает и настраивается как обычный ethernet:
- либо dhcp (обычно это через tethereing)
- либо статика
Однако, чтобы Tethering работал, его надо активировать на Андроиде, на которых обычно бывает
выбор: Windows Tethering или OS/X tethering.
Для FreeBSD -> OS/X (или MacOS) tethering. Не факт что будет работать в случае Windows tethering.
Чтобы что-то определить, нужно воспользоваться командами:
# ifconfig ue0
# arp -a
# netstat -rn
# cat /etc/resolv.conf
...
# ps axuww | grep dhclient
# ls -la /var/db/dhclient.leases.ue0
# cat /var/db/dhclient.leases.ue0
Здесь могут Вам помочь, но вытягивать из Вас данные...
На всякий случай, обычно, обычно, Смартфоны на базе Android, имеют:
- WiFi
- Bluetooth
- USB
далее зависит от версии Android и реализации, но все три из вышеуказанных, можно использовать
в качестве tethering для IP-Share Connectivity.
Вероятно, USB - самый простой, ибо при подключении, использует usb-ethernet connectivity,
понятно что на смартфоне, нужно активировать tethering через USB, на смартфоне, автоматически
должен запуститься dhcp-сервер, который и будет отдавать данные для автоматической
настройки, dhcp-клиенту - те нашему ПК или Буку, так работает tethering.
USB Tethering в FreeBSD худо бедно поддерживается.
Для WiFi - как я понимаю, вариантов больше, для Bluetooth - Bluetooth PAN через access point mode.
Условия: Android с поддержкой Tethering, Android не ниже 4.x (иначе потребуется root доступ),
и если в Tethering есть варианты: Windows or OS/X -> выбор OS/X, если нет - хорошо, просто tethering.
Смысловая часть на пальцах - расписана, ну а в час по чайной ложке, точнее раз в день - это мазохизм.
FreeBSD - требует изучения, если же Вам нужен *nix на нотебуке с поддержкой массы устройств и
технологий для работы, а не для изучения-освоения, лучше установите Linux, например Ubuntu, там
Network Manager сделает массу работы за Вас.
Ну или продолжим, это будет тягомотно.